Full House star Dave Coulier has opened up about the side effects of chemotherapy.
“The side effects have side effects,” Coulier, 65, said in the latest episode of his Full House Rewind podcast.
He continued: “And then you take a drug to counteract that and this and that. So it’s this constant cocktail where your body is in fight or flight mode and you’re just trying to adjust to, ‘Okay, how am I adjusting to steroids? How am I adjusting to the chemo cocktail?’”
Coulier remarked that his body is in the state of “a constant fight.”
“It’s a little bit of an internal battle,” he continued.
In November 2024, the Fuller House star shared that he is battling aggressive Stage 3 non-Hodgkin lymphoma.
He got his diagnosis after first suffering from an infection of the upper respiratory tract that resulted in severe swelling of his lymph nodes. This led to PET and CT scans, which unmasked the cancer.
“Three days later, my doctors called me back and they said, ‘We wish we had better news for you, but you have non-Hodgkin’s lymphoma and it’s called B cell and it’s very aggressive,” Coulier told the publication at the time.
“I went from, ‘I got a little bit of a head cold’ to, ‘I have cancer’ and it was pretty overwhelming. This has been a really fast roller coaster ride of a journey,” he shared.
